| Error Message / Symptom | Likely Cause | Solution |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| SD card is not FAT32, or file is in a subfolder. | Reformat SD card to FAT32. Place .upd file in root. | | Update stalls at 0% | Corrupt download or low battery. | Re-download firmware. Charge Z6 for 1 hour, then retry. | | Device won't turn on after update | "Bricked" state due to power interruption. | Perform a "deep reset": Hold Power + Volume Down for 20 seconds. Then, try updating again via PC tool. | | Bluetooth not working post-update | Firmware cache conflict. | Go to Settings > Bluetooth > Clear Pairing History . Restart. | | "Firmware mismatch" error | Wrong hardware version file. | Double-check your Z6 hardware revision in About menu. | Where to Find Legitimate Phinistec Z6 Firmware Files Warning: Do not download firmware from random file-sharing sites (Mediafire, Dropbox links from unknown users).
